Plot Summary: The drama revolves around the intertwining
lives of two families, the Sheikh and Bajwa families, as they navigate the
journey of organizing a series of weddings. Filled with humorous incidents,
romantic entanglements, and unexpected twists, the plot captures the essence of
Pakistani weddings, showcasing the traditions, customs, and familial bonds that
define such joyous occasions.
Cast and Characters:
- Bushra
Ansari as Farhat Baji (Sheikh family): A veteran actress, Bushra
Ansari, brings life to the character of Farhat Baji, the matriarch of the
Sheikh family. Her impeccable comic timing and emotional depth add layers
to the character, making Farhat Baji a memorable and beloved figure in the
drama.
- Saba
Hameed as Naima Bajwa (Bajwa family): Saba Hameed portrays Naima
Bajwa, the head of the Bajwa family. Known for her versatile acting
skills, Hameed infuses the character with grace, portraying the challenges
and triumphs of a mother steering her family through the ups and downs of
wedding preparations.
- Samina
Ahmad as Dolly Phuppo: Samina Ahmad's portrayal of Dolly Phuppo, the
quirky and outspoken relative, adds a delightful touch to the drama. Her
humorous interactions and meddling nature contribute to the comedic
elements of "Jin Ki Ayegi Barat."
- Javed
Sheikh as Sajjad Sheikh: Javed Sheikh, a seasoned actor, takes on the
role of Sajjad Sheikh, the patriarch of the Sheikh family. Sheikh's
charismatic presence and nuanced performance bring depth to the character,
capturing the essence of a loving and protective father.
- Alishba
Yousuf as Nida Sheikh: Alishba Yousuf plays Nida Sheikh, the lead
character in the drama. Her journey through love, family expectations, and
personal growth forms the core of the storyline, and Yousuf's emotive
performance resonates with the audience.
